Hey all - just got back from the World and had to put my two cents in. We did 1900 Park Fare (Cinderella) for dinner, loved it. Akershaus (Mulan, Snow White, Aurora, JAsmine tableside with formal picture with Belle before being seated) for breakfast, very nice.
But the overall winner - Ohana Breakfast with Stitch and Friends. You get Mickey (awesome) & Pluto (all ages genders seem to love him!) and of course Lilo and Stitch. Stitch was a hoot, sweet with the kids but a total brat to the grown ups...wwe laughed so hard when he kept ignoring my "kid" sister (she's 27) who was begging for his attention. He finally gave in and had a pic done with her of course, but even as we were leaving he wiggled his hands by his ears in a "nah nah nah nah" gesture at her. All the characters lead the kids in a parade around the restaurant, the little ones (three girls, ages 4.5 - 5) had a blast. I would reccomend this one to families with kids of all ages.
